OUTPUT MODE submenu
Select Level A or Level B as the serial link multiplexing method, or select HD
mode. Use the left (◄)orright(
►) arrow button to select from the Level A,
Level B or HD choices listed below. Press the ENTER button to confirm the
selection. The following figure shows the OUTPUT MODE submenu.

Level A. This is one way of constructing the 3 Gb/s serial data stream, as
described in SMPTE 425. For the mapping structure 1 signals such as 1080p50,
1080p59.94 and 1080p60, a Level A stream looks similar to HD video (as defined
in SMPTE 292), except the data rate is twice as fast. In Level A, the lines
are sent in order, consecutively. For other mapping structures, the video is at a
lower frame rate, but has more bits and/or includes more channels. Refer to the
SMPTE 425 standard for details on the Level A mapping method.
Level B. This is an alternate way of constructing the 3 Gb/s serial data stream, as
described in SMPTE 425. A Level B stream looks similar to dual link (as defined
in SMPTE 372M). The serial data is constructed by interleaving the two links of
the dual link video signal. As a result, some formats will have the s erial data take
two lines worth of time to propagate. This has implications for the effects of the
pathological signals, and can confuse the definition of timing adjustments. Refer
to the SMPTE 372M and SMPTE 425 standards for more information.
2K × 1080. Available in both Level A and Level B mapping, this selection
provides 2048 × 1080 resolution signals, primarily for digital cinema applications.
2×HD. Available in Level B mapping, 2×HD signals pro
vide two standard
SMPTE 292 HD streams in the same format (for example 1080i 59.94). Select
between Test Signal/Test Signal or Test Signal/Black for the two streams.
HD. Available when the HD mode is selected. The output is a 1.485 G b/s
SMPTE 292 compliant signal.
